This hotel shouldn't be 4 stars : staff hate you 'gym' is an old treadmill and the pool is tiny - clearly there to tick boxes inorder to win an extra star or two food is pretty poor (stale bread)

Pros:

The hotel was very quiet, which is probably why we got our deluxe double room so cheap. The room was spacious and clean, with a balcony with no view to write home about.

The sauna was good (possibly because we had it to ourselves thanks to no other guests) three separate saunas and only charged €15 for a couple hours. We were given two towels each.

The location is incredible, right next to the lake and a stones throw away from places to eat.

Cons:

I wouldn't want to stay more than one night here with the poor service.

There was a female receptionist and a female waitress who were friendly and helpful. The rest of the staff we encountered were very unfriendly and apparently did not like having to deal with guests at all. They did not smile, and at several times after interactions (as simple as good morning) seemed to sigh and mutter to themselves as we walked away.

At dinner and breakfast, a male staff member would loudly clear and set tables around us and keep looking over to us even though it was well before end of service. We were the only ones left because there were so few guests to begin with.

At breakfast this morning I couldn't finish my sandwich, so I wrapped it in a napkin to take with me. A male member of staff waited for me by the exit and tried to charge me €4.50 to take it. When I questioned the price (€4.50 for a half eaten sandwich) he told me to sit back down and finish it. I said nvm and gave it to him, and he scolded me "next time make sure you can eat everything you take." I know some hotels don't let you take food out of breakfast, but this didn't feel like someone 'just doing their job' it felt like a miserable person on a power trip. It made me feel so unwelcome I rushed to check out.

A quiet hotel should allow more room for hospitality, not less witnesses for rude behaviour. Despite the incredible location I wouldn't recommend anyone staying here more...

If this place called itself three star I might have given it an extra star but to call it four star is a bit of a joke. My wife described the decor as like being in student accommodation. The biggest single problem with our stay during a heatwave was the lack of air conditioning which made for uncomfortable nights sleeping. The rooms furnishing was basic but functional, bathroom was fine. The breakfast buffet is reasonable but not the best we had in Slovenia by any means. The service was generally a bit surly and nit picking in ways you do not expect from a good hotel. Finally we got a smile on the last morning when after grudgingly negotiating an hour extension to check out on one of three rooms to 11am, we brought the kids back beaming from the tandem paragliding experience this allowed them to enjoy.

The gym is so underequipped as to be barely there although there was a table tennis table which was a plus. The pool is nothing to write home about but the annoying thing was the lack of towels. If you want to use a separate towel for the hotel pools, or for the nearby beaches (pebbly) or the watersports on the lake, you are out of luck. They will not give you or even hire you any extra towels other than your room bath towel (I do not expect to be taking my own towels to a "four star" hotel). The oddest thing was the toilet serving the restaurants had a turnstile that seemed to require 50c, although this was out of operation so it turned out they were not actually charging their restaurant guests to use the facilities (but might they another time?) We tried the hotel a la carte restaurant Zlatovcica on the first night which was adequate but no more.

The location is good as it is a short walk to the lake with various places offering watersports and the jetty for the passenger boats across the lake. Parking was sufficient although the barriers to get into the larger car part were not...

We are here right now and have a four night stay booked. We thought about leaving after the first night. This hotel is fine if you are expecting a MAXIMUM three star hotel. It is completely false advertising for them to call themselves a four star hotel. It is desperately in need of updating and they should be clear on their website that there is no AC. I have never stayed in a four star hotel anywhere in the world without AC. Nap times for my littles have been nightmarishly hot. There are no coffee/tea facilities in the rooms, you have to bring your own beach towels (which is not made clear in advance), you are nickel and dimed for everything (you have to rent the fridge in your room, you have an added fee for cribs even though kids under a certain age are reportedly free and more), safe in the room doesn’t work, breakfast is basic and there are tacky signs everywhere forbidding people to take food away from breakfast to the point that I felt nervous about taking a banana for my toddler. An awful sewage smell comes up from the drains in the bathroom in the morning and the bathroom is super old. We are really bummed. The only reason why I gave this two stars is because the room cleaning person is good and the parking is free. Grasping at...

Hotel Jezero - far from four stars Pros: good location directly at the lake, private parking available for the guests, helpful staff at the reception, comfy bed But... there are a lot of significant cons: • Breakfast buffet is average, rather up to a standard that was acceptable 10-15 years ago • Dated, old fashioned furniture everywhere - think of a hotel in the 90's and you get the feeling • Insufficient light in the room and the bathroom, poor lamps, no reading light for the 3rd bed at all • No A/C, not even a vent in the room - it was too hot despite of the cool temp outside at night • The worst part is the bathroom/toilet. Dirty and dated, even mouldy surfaces (see photos) - UNACCEPTABLE for a 4-star hotel. No ventillation (or it did not work at all). • Paint peeling off from the ceiling (see photos) • No room safe - having the window/balcony door (which you need to keep open at night due to the lack of A/C) literally just a jump away from the street it would have been a must, especially for a hotel claiming 4 stars Overall, Hotel Jezero is heavily overpriced compared to the quality and service level, it is not at all up to the standard of a 4-star hotel. Happy to have spent just a single night here.

The hotel does not justify four stars. We stayed at Hotel Jezero from October 18th to 20th, and unfortunately, we were disappointed with our experience. The hotel advertises itself as a four-star establishment, but based on our stay, we don’t believe it deserves this rating. The room was average, lacking basic amenities like slippers and bathrobes, which are standard in hotels of this category. The hairdryer in the bathroom was so weak that it couldn’t even dry short hair. There was no kettle or tea in the room, something we expected given the hotel’s rating. The minibar was empty, which is not up to par with the standards of a four-star hotel. The dinner included in the SelectBox package was disappointing. On your website, “golden trout” is translated as “goldfish,” which is not only incorrect but also a bit absurd. Overall, the hotel did not meet our expectations, and the level of service and amenities does not justify the price or its four-star rating. We believe the hotel should seriously consider improving its service to live up to the standards it advertises.

The highlight for this hotel is it's location, right next to Bohinj Lake. It really is a beautiful area. There's two sections to the hotel, what I assume to be the original building, along side the road and and extension where I was staying. All rooms have balconies, mine was over looking a crazy golf course and beyond that, the lake. There was also a family of herons nesting in the tree opposite. The room itself was large and very clean. The bed was comfortable with extra blankets and pillows if you need. Yes, it can get hot in the room due to the lack of air conditioning but, it's so quiet, I left the door and window open without any problems. The food is fantastic with some really interesting things to choose from. Shark was a highlight for me! Local wine is freely available at dinner along with Tuborg beer, soft drinks and water. The staff are lovely and so friendly. Needless to say, they all speak fantastic English. I also heard German being spoken also.
